Understanding Thalassaemia

Africa8 hr ago

Thalassaemia is a genetic blood disorder that affects the body's ability to produce hemoglobin. Hemoglobin is essential for carrying oxygen throughout the body. Individuals with thalassaemia produce less hemoglobin than normal, leading to anemia. This inherited condition is passed down from parents to children through genes. There are several types of thalassaemia, ranging in severity from mild to life-threatening. The most common forms include alpha thalassaemia and beta thalassaemia. Symptoms can vary widely depending on the type and severity, but often include fatigue, weakness, pale skin, and slow growth in children. Severe forms may require regular blood transfusions and lifelong medical care. Genetic counseling and carrier screening are important for families with a history of the disorder. Research continues to explore potential treatments and cures for thalassaemia.
